    摘要:

    當TCP協(xié)議應用于異構網(wǎng)絡(luò )時(shí)業(yè)務(wù)的QoS無(wú)法得到保障,具體而言,一方面TCP協(xié)議與無(wú)線(xiàn)網(wǎng)絡(luò )適配性較差,導致網(wǎng)絡(luò )丟包率升高、吞吐量下降;另一方面,TCP協(xié)議對于業(yè)務(wù)不區分優(yōu)先級,不能滿(mǎn)足高優(yōu)先級業(yè)務(wù)的需求。因此,文章提出了異構網(wǎng)絡(luò )中基于捕食模型的保障業(yè)務(wù)QoS的TCP協(xié)議(QoS - Internet Predator based on Prey Model,Q-IPPM)。Q-IPPM算法不僅會(huì )根據異構網(wǎng)絡(luò )的帶寬改進(jìn)TCP協(xié)議的擁塞控制架構,還根據不同業(yè)務(wù)的負載狀況和優(yōu)先級控制不同業(yè)務(wù)流量占比。實(shí)驗結果表明,Q-IPPM算法不僅可以提顯著(zhù)提高異構網(wǎng)絡(luò )的吞吐量,降低網(wǎng)絡(luò )丟包率,還能夠根據業(yè)務(wù)優(yōu)先級和負載狀況將帶寬“按需分配”給不同業(yè)務(wù),從而保障了異構網(wǎng)絡(luò )中業(yè)務(wù)的QoS。

    Abstract:

    AbstractIn heterogeneous network, a large number of business USES the TCP protocol to transmit, but when the TCP protocol is applied to heterogeneous network, QoS can not be guaranteed. Specifically, on one hand, the TCP protocol and the wireless network are less adaptable, leading to the increase of packet loss rate and the decrease of throughput. On the other hand, the TCP protocol does not prioritize business and does not guarantee high priority business requirements. Therefore, the article proposes a TCP protocol (QoS - Internet Predator based on Prey Model, Q-IPPM) that safeguards business in heterogeneous networks. The q-ippm algorithm not only improves the congestion control architecture of TCP protocol based on the bandwidth of heterogeneous network, but also controls different traffic ratio according to different business load conditions and priority level. The experimental results show that the Q-IPPM algorithm not only can significantly increase the throughput of heterogeneous network, reduce the network packet loss rate, can also according to the business priorities and load status will be bandwidth "to each according to his need" to different business, to ensure the QoS in heterogeneous network environment of the business.
